Overview

Theme park attractions operate as live entertainment systems that require high reliability technical infrastructure, operational readiness, and immediate troubleshooting response under live guest conditions.

This experience included technical support for attraction audio systems, video playback systems, projection systems, PLC based control interfaces, show timing systems, and operational recovery workflows across rides, shows, and seasonal entertainment environments.

The work required fast technical decision making, strong troubleshooting skills, clear communication, and the ability to support systems where downtime directly impacted guest experience and attraction availability.

Guest Facing Technical Reliability

Attraction and themed entertainment systems are different from traditional back of house technical environments because every fault can immediately affect show quality, guest flow, attraction uptime, and operations. The work required a practical understanding of how audio, video, projection, show control, diagnostics, ride systems, and operations teams interact in a live guest facing environment.

Supporting these systems meant responding quickly, documenting issues clearly, coordinating with operations and maintenance partners, and protecting the intended creative experience while maintaining safe and reliable technical performance.

Technical Disciplines

The work was not limited to one attraction or one system type. It required a broad technical foundation across the systems that make themed entertainment environments operate reliably every day.

Attraction Audio Systems

Support and maintenance of distributed attraction audio systems used throughout rides, queue environments, preshows, walkthrough attractions, and live entertainment venues.

  • Distributed themed audio systems
  • DSP routing and signal distribution
  • Amplifier systems and loudspeaker monitoring
  • Multi zone attraction playback systems
  • Show quality monitoring and troubleshooting

Show Control and Ride Systems

Support and troubleshooting of attraction show control systems used to coordinate ride timing, show events, diagnostics, and operational interfaces.

  • PLC based attraction support systems
  • Operator interface and touchscreen systems
  • Show timing and sequencing support
  • Technical diagnostics and fault recovery
  • Attraction system status monitoring

Video and Projection Infrastructure

Support and maintenance of attraction playback systems, projection environments, monitor systems, and rack based video infrastructure.

  • Attraction video playback systems
  • Projection and monitor infrastructure
  • Rack mounted routing and playback systems
  • Queue and preshow video systems
  • Playback diagnostics and troubleshooting

Live Technical Operations

Technical response within live guest facing entertainment environments requiring operational continuity and coordination across multiple teams.

  • Real time operational troubleshooting
  • Mission critical technical response
  • Overnight maintenance support
  • Show quality preservation
  • Technical documentation and reporting

Operational Scope and Responsibilities

Responsibilities included maintaining show quality, responding to operational faults, supporting maintenance activities, communicating attraction readiness, documenting unscheduled work, and assisting with process improvements that enhanced system efficiency and reliability.

The role also required supporting requests from multiple operating groups, maintaining equipment in safe operating condition, coordinating repairs, and helping sustain inventory levels needed for efficient technical operations.
